Problem

Scissor-switch keyboards have a complex and laborious assembly process due to their design, which can lead to damage of metal hooks and affect durability and haptic feedback.

Innovation Solution

A key module and keyboard configuration featuring a base with assembly frames, pivotable frames, and a keycap, where the pivotable frames are guided by guide portions to engage with the base, allowing for smooth assembly and preventing damage, ensuring durability and haptic feedback.

1Strength

If metal hooks are used in scissor-switch keyboards, then the keyboard can achieve required strength and durability, but the assembly process becomes complicated and laborious, and the metal hooks often cause damage to interlocked pieces

Engineering Contradiction:
ImprovedurabilityVSAvoidassembly process
Core Design Contradiction:
StrengthVSEase of manufacture

Solution Approach 1:

The patent introduces a plastic base with molded engagement features as an intermediary component between the scissor mechanism and the keycap. This plastic base includes recesses and protrusions that guide and secure the scissor switches during assembly, eliminating the need for metal hooks. The intermediary plastic component simplifies the assembly process while maintaining the required structural strength and durability of the keyboard.

2Strength

If metal hooks are used in scissor-switch keyboards, then the keyboard can achieve required strength, but the metal hooks cause damage to interlocked pieces affecting haptic feedback

Engineering Contradiction:
ImprovestrengthVSAvoiddamage to interlocked pieces
Core Design Contradiction:
StrengthVSObject-affected harmful factors

Solution Approach 1:

The patent replaces durable metal hooks with a plastic base component that is designed to be replaced if damaged. The plastic base includes integrated engagement features that are less likely to cause damage to the scissor mechanism. While plastic may be less durable than metal, it eliminates the harmful sharp edges of metal hooks that damage interlocked pieces and degrade haptic feedback over time.

3Length of moving object

If a regular frame is used for scissor-switch keyboards, then the frame can provide extra room for long key travel, but the frame becomes thick

Engineering Contradiction:
Improvekey travelVSAvoidframe thickness
Core Design Contradiction:
Length of moving objectVSLength of stationary object

Solution Approach 1:

The patent implements a nested structure where the scissor mechanism is positioned within recesses of the base, and the pivotable frames are integrated into the base structure. This nesting arrangement allows the scissor switches to have sufficient key travel distance while keeping the overall frame thickness minimal. The components are arranged in nested layers rather than requiring a thick frame to accommodate all elements.

AI summary

This disclosure relates to a key module including a base, a first pivotable frame, a second pivotable frame and a keycap. The base includes two assembly frames. Each of the assembly frames includes an engagement portion and two guide portions. The engagement portion is connected to and located between the guide portions. The first pivotable frame is engaged with the engagement portion by being guided by the guide portions of the assembly frames. The second pivotable frame is engaged with the engagement portion by being guided by the guide portions of the assembly frames. The keycap includes a press part, a first engagement part and a second engagement part. The first engagement part and the second engagement part are connected to the press part. The first pivotable frame is engaged with the first engagement part, and the second pivotable frame is engaged with the second engagement part.
